Package configurationslicing.logrotator
Class LogRotationSlicer.ArtifactBuildsSliceSpec
- java.lang.Object
-
- configurationslicing.UnorderedStringSlicer.UnorderedStringSlicerSpec<Job>
-
- configurationslicing.logrotator.LogRotationSlicer.AbstractLogRotationSliceSpec
-
- configurationslicing.logrotator.LogRotationSlicer.ArtifactBuildsSliceSpec
-
- Enclosing class:
- LogRotationSlicer
public static class LogRotationSlicer.ArtifactBuildsSliceSpec extends LogRotationSlicer.AbstractLogRotationSliceSpec
-
-
Constructor Summary
Constructors Constructor Description ArtifactBuildsSliceSpec()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ected int
getNewArtifactBuilds(int oldValue, int newValue)
protected String
getValue(LogRotator rotator)
-
Methods inherited from class configurationslicing.logrotator.LogRotationSlicer.AbstractLogRotationSliceSpec
getDefaultValueString, getName, getName, getNewArtifactDays, getNewBuilds, getNewDays, getUrl, getValues, getWorkDomain, setValues
-
Methods inherited from class configurationslicing.UnorderedStringSlicer.UnorderedStringSlicerSpec
getCommonValueStrings, getConfiguredValueDescription, getValueIndex, getValueIndex, isBlankNeededForValues, isIndexUsed, isValueTrimmed
-
-
-
-
Method Detail
-
getValue
protected String getValue(LogRotator rotator)
- Specified by:
getValue
in classLogRotationSlicer.AbstractLogRotationSliceSpec
-
getNewArtifactBuilds
protected int getNewArtifactBuilds(int oldValue, int newValue)
- Overrides:
getNewArtifactBuilds
in classLogRotationSlicer.AbstractLogRotationSliceSpec
-
-